How To Clean Magnetic Lashes: A Comprehensive Maintenance Guide For Longevity
Maintaining the integrity of magnetic lashes requires a precise, non-solvent-based cleaning protocol to protect the synthetic fibers and the micro-magnetic strip integrity. By utilizing specific oil-free cleansing agents and gentle mechanical agitation, you can extend the lifespan of your lashes to thirty uses or more while preventing bacterial accumulation along the lash band.
Essential Preparation and Tool Requirements for Lash Sanitization
Before beginning the cleaning process, verify that your workspace is organized and clear of debris to prevent the micro-magnets from attracting stray metal particles. Proper maintenance is contingent upon using the correct chemical agents; oil-based cleansers are strictly prohibited as they compromise the adhesive bond between the synthetic hair and the magnetic strip.
- Essential Equipment:
- Oil-free micellar water or a specialized lash extension cleanser (pH-balanced).
- Lint-free microfiber swabs or a soft, medical-grade silicone wand.
- A clean, dry paper towel or lint-free cosmetic cloth.
- A pair of dull-tipped, plastic-coated tweezers for handling.
- Mandatory Standards:
- Temperature Range: Utilize lukewarm water only; extreme heat can warp the synthetic fiber curls.
- Chemical Exposure: Avoid alcohol-based toners, acetone, or harsh disinfectants that degrade the flexible lash band.
- Duration Benchmark: The entire cleaning cycle should take approximately 5 to 7 minutes of active care, followed by 30 minutes of air-drying.
Procedural Workflow for Deep-Cleaning Magnetic Lashes
Executing the cleaning process correctly involves a focus on the magnetic strip where mascara buildup and eyeliner residue most frequently accumulate. This procedure ensures the magnets remain flush against the skin for a secure, gap-free application during subsequent uses.
Step 1: Residue Removal from the Magnetic Strip
Using your plastic tweezers, gently pick away any dried eyeliner residue clinging to the individual magnets. Magnetic eyeliner often contains iron oxides that can build up, creating a crust that prevents the top and bottom lashes from snapping together effectively. Do not use metal tools, as they may scratch the coating of the magnets or cause the magnets to detach from the lash band.
Step 2: Precision Cleansing of Synthetic Fibers
Soak a lint-free swab in an oil-free micellar solution. Gently stroke the synthetic lash fibers from the base toward the tips to remove mascara or environmental dust. Use a second, clean swab to wipe the magnets themselves.
Pro-Tip: If your lashes are heavily saturated with waterproof mascara, perform the cleaning process in two phases, allowing the micellar water to dwell on the fibers for 60 seconds before wiping to break down the polymers without mechanical pulling.
Step 3: Decontamination of the Lash Band
The lash band acts as the structural foundation. Apply a small amount of mild, fragrance-free facial cleanser diluted with water to a soft brush and lightly scrub the band. This removes facial oils that degrade the structural integrity of the flexible band.
Step 4: Controlled Drying and Shape Retention
Never use a hairdryer or direct heat source to dry your lashes. Place the damp lashes on a clean paper towel in a well-ventilated area. Once the fibers are touch-dry, place them back into their original storage case in their curved, "C" or "D" shape. Storing them flat will cause the band to lose its ergonomic curvature, resulting in discomfort during future wear.

Technical Specifications and Material Maintenance Parameters
Understanding the composition of your lashes is critical for selecting the correct cleaning medium. Synthetic mink (PBT fibers) behaves differently than faux silk under chemical stress.
| Lash Component | Cleaning Sensitivity | Recommended Agent | Avoidance Protocol |
|---|---|---|---|
| Synthetic Mink (PBT) | Moderate | Micellar Water | Oil-based cleansers, high heat |
| Faux Silk | High | Mild Saline/Water | Alcohol, chemical solvents |
| Magnetic Strip | Extreme | Dry swab/Gentle wipe | Metal scrapers, abrasive scrubs |
| Flexible Band | Moderate | Fragrance-free soap | Stretching or bending while wet |
Common Field Failures and Remediation Techniques
Even with meticulous care, environmental factors or improper storage can lead to performance degradation. Addressing these issues early prevents premature replacement.
- Root Cause: Magnet Displacement
- Actionable Fix: If a magnet becomes slightly misaligned, do not attempt to re-glue it with household adhesives. Use a minute amount of cyanoacrylate-free lash adhesive to secure it. If the magnet has completely detached, the structural integrity is compromised, and the lash set should be replaced.
- Root Cause: Loss of Lash Curl
- Actionable Fix: If the fibers appear limp, hold the lashes over a gentle steam source for 3 seconds—do not touch the steam—and then use a spoolie brush to manually reset the curl pattern while the fibers are pliable.
- Root Cause: Weak Magnetic Connection
- Actionable Fix: This is typically caused by residual iron oxide buildup on the magnets. Perform a deep cleaning using a high-concentration micellar water, ensuring you reach the crevices between the magnet and the band.
Frequently Asked Questions
Can I soak my magnetic lashes in water?
No, submersing magnetic lashes is discouraged. Soaking can weaken the adhesive bonding the magnets to the band and may cause the synthetic fibers to lose their factory-set curl. Always use a damp cloth or swab method instead.
How often should I clean my magnetic lashes?
You should perform a light cleaning after every 2-3 wears to prevent buildup. If you notice a decrease in the strength of the magnetic "click" or visible clumps of eyeliner on the magnets, clean them immediately regardless of the usage count.
Is it safe to use makeup remover on the lashes?
Only if the makeup remover is explicitly labeled as "oil-free" and "safe for lash extensions." Oil-based removers will penetrate the adhesive seal, eventually causing the magnetic strips to fall off the lash band entirely.
Will cleaning shorten the lifespan of my magnetic lashes?
On the contrary, failing to clean them will significantly shorten their lifespan. Accumulated oils and makeup residue can cause the band to become brittle and the magnets to lose their surface contact, leading to a loss of the lash set.
